Frequently Asked Questions

How can I find a local optometrist in Machias, ME?

In Machias, you can find local optometrists by checking with the Down East Community Hospital for affiliated providers, searching the Maine Optometric Association's online directory, or asking for recommendations from primary care physicians at the Machias Bay Area Health Center. Local pharmacies and optical shops may also have referral lists for eye doctors serving the Washington County area.

What should I look for when choosing an optometrist in a rural area like Machias?

When choosing an optometrist in Machias, consider their range of on-site services, as travel to larger cities like Bangor for specialized care can be significant. Look for practices that offer comprehensive eye exams, manage ocular diseases like glaucoma and diabetic retinopathy, and have modern diagnostic equipment. It's also beneficial to find a provider who understands the specific visual needs of coastal and outdoor lifestyles common in Downeast Maine.

Do optometrists in Machias accept MaineCare or other state insurance plans?

Many optometrists in the Machias area do accept MaineCare (Maine's Medicaid) and other state-managed plans, but coverage for adult routine eye exams can be limited. It is crucial to contact the optometry office directly to verify acceptance of your specific plan, as provider participation can vary. Some practices may also offer sliding scale fees or payment plans for uninsured patients, given the economic diversity of Washington County.

What eye care services are typically available from optometrists in Machias?

Optometrists in Machias typically provide comprehensive eye exams, prescriptions for glasses and contact lenses, and diagnosis and management of eye diseases such as cataracts, macular degeneration, and dry eye syndrome. Given the area's older demographic, many focus on geriatric eye care. Some practices may also offer pre- and post-operative care for patients who travel to surgical centers, and pediatric vision screenings coordinated with local schools.

How far in advance should I schedule an appointment with a Machias optometrist, and what should I bring?

Due to a smaller number of providers serving a large geographic area, it's advisable to schedule routine eye exams in Machias several weeks to a couple of months in advance, especially for popular times like summer. For an appointment, bring your current glasses or contact lens information, a list of medications, your insurance cards, and any referral forms if required. If you have a complex medical history related to conditions like diabetes or hypertension, bring relevant medical records to assist in your eye health evaluation.

Finding a Same Day Eye Exam Near Me in Machias, ME: A Local's Guide

Living in the beautiful but remote Downeast region of Machias, Maine, means planning ahead is a way of life. However, when it comes to your vision, some issues can't wait. Whether you've broken your only pair of glasses, developed sudden eye discomfort, or have a child with a potential eye injury, knowing how to secure a same day eye exam near you is crucial. For Machias residents, this requires a bit of local know-how, as our options differ from those in larger metropolitan areas.

First, understand that true "walk-in" availability is rare here. The most effective strategy is to call your local optometry office as soon as they open. Explain your urgent situation clearly—be it sudden blurry vision, significant redness, pain, or a lost or broken corrective lens. Offices in our community, like those serving the students of UMaine Machias and the local workforce, often reserve slots for genuine emergencies. Being polite and specific about your symptoms can help the staff prioritize your need for a same day eye exam.

Timing and weather are significant local factors. Calling early on a weekday is best, as many offices have shorter hours or are closed on weekends. Also, consider the long Machias winters: a sudden snowstorm can make travel difficult or cause delays. If you have an urgent need, don't wait until the weather worsens. Plan your trip to the eye doctor with the same caution you'd use for any essential errand during our Maine winters.

If your primary eye care provider cannot accommodate you, ask them for a referral. The close-knit professional network among healthcare providers in Washington County means your optometrist might know which colleague has an opening. As a last resort for severe trauma or sudden vision loss, the Emergency Department at Down East Community Hospital can address immediate medical concerns, though they won't provide a comprehensive vision exam or new glasses prescription.

Preparation is key. Before your appointment, jot down your symptoms and their timeline. Bring your current glasses, a list of medications, and your insurance information. This helps the visit go smoothly and efficiently, respecting both your time and the doctor's packed schedule.

Ultimately, while finding a same day eye exam near me in Machias requires proactive steps, it is possible. Building a relationship with a local optometrist for your routine care makes it much easier to access help when you need it urgently. They understand the unique challenges of living in our region and are committed to caring for the vision health of our community, even when needs arise unexpectedly.
